Break-glass: Calwright sync conflicts. If the Ostermere calendar bridge wedges on a duplicate-event conflict and paging Nerivault admin fails, on-call may unlock the conflict queue directly via the emergency console. This bypasses audit holds, so file an incident afterward. The console prompts for the break-glass recovery passphrase, which is recorded below.

strongbox words: fraath-isteth

**Q: Why did BranchReaper delete a customer's branch?**

BranchReaper only archives branches with no commits for 90 days and no open merge requests. Deleted branches are recoverable for 30 days via the restore command. If a customer disputes a deletion, collect the branch name and repo, then follow the restore guide on the page below.

wiki page, tahaf-tajog: https://jira.ordindyn.corp/pipeline

For the weekly sync: the ScanBridge barcode-scanner integration has been failing since Tuesday because the credential used to reach our internal device-registry service expired silently — no renewal alert fired, which is a separate gap we should track. All scan events are queued, nothing lost, but warehouse dashboards are stale. I've provisioned a replacement credential with a 90-day lifetime and added an expiry monitor. For anyone validating the fix locally, the replacement key is below.

gateway credential: kto3_qfe